I bought a Sony DSC W320 cybershot camera from Finland in May 2010 expecting high quality product and services. However to my surprise the camera started malfunctioning within a couple of months - it started getting hung with a light green display and required me to take out the battery each time in order to make it function again. To get this issue checked I took the camera to Sony's south extention service center where after checking it for about 5-10 mins, the technician told me that there was no issue found with the camera.
I continued to use the defective camera with the same hard boot (taking out battery ) trick uptil last month when the camera suddenly stopped powering on inspite of the battery being fully charged. I again took the camera to CLUB ELECTRONICS (SONY AUTHORIZED SERVICE CENTRE) South Extention on 28th August'11, where I was told that it will require an inspection.
After two days of submitting the camera, I got the due call on 30th Aug'11 and was told that there is some motherboard to be replaced due to some circuit issue that has come up - please note, the technician maintained that the cause doesnt seem like a physical damage or spillage.
Now, came the big surprise - I was told that since I bought the camera outside India, the 3 year warranty wont apply and I'll have to pay INR 2965 for the same. When I queried more, I was suggested to call up on SONYs toll free number [protected] and get details on how international warranty could be bought for the said camera.
